If you’re eager to try the smoky eye look, follow the step-by-step guide and accompanying video below; it’s simpler than it seems and takes less than 10 minutes! You will need a Cole Pencil Eyeliner, a dark brown transition powder, some mascara, and a quality eyeshadow brush (the new Morphy brush line is my favorite).

Step 1: Prepare the waterline, tight line, and top lid

For the tight line, I utilized Neutrogena Smokey Kohl eyeliner. It sets quickly, so blending should be done swiftly. Using a small eyeshadow brush, apply the liner under the waterline and along the top lid to achieve a smooth base.

Step 2: Blend the liner with a fluffy brush and transition shade

I used the Huda Beauty Pretty Grunge palette, specifically the dark brown shade “Hope” which @PaintedByspencer recommends. However, any dark brown powder will suffice. Take a fluffy brush, dip it in the powder, and gradually mix it into the liner, blending towards the crease until you achieve your desired effect. Repeat these steps on the lower lash line as well.

Step 3: Diffuse the edges with a large fluffy brush

Continue blending the edges until you obtain your ideal look. I went back to add more eyeliner for added intensity across my eyelid. Finally, finish with multiple coats of mascara to enhance the lashes and complete the smoky eye.
